Ignoring Soil Health
The foundation of any thriving garden is healthy soil. Many homeowners overlook this crucial aspect, resulting in poor plant growth. Regularly test your soil’s pH and nutrient levels to ensure it meets plant needs. Adding compost or organic matter can improve soil quality, promoting stronger plants.
Overwatering Your Plants
One major blunder in landscape maintenance is overwatering. It’s tempting to water frequently, thinking more is better. However, too much water can harm plants, leading to root rot and other issues. Instead, adjust watering schedules based on the season and plant type for optimal results.

Poor Plant Placement
Placing plants in unsuitable locations is another frequent mistake. Each plant has specific light and space requirements. Ignoring these needs can stunt their growth. Before planting, research each species’ preferences, ensuring they get enough sunlight and room to thrive.
Forgetting About Pruning
Regular pruning keeps plants healthy and encourages new growth. Neglecting this task can lead to overgrown and unhealthy shrubs or trees. Learn proper pruning techniques for different plants and schedule routine trims throughout the year for best results.
Lack of Weed Control
Weeds compete with your plants for nutrients and water. Failing to control them allows weeds to take over, affecting plant health. Implement a weed management plan using mulching, hand-pulling, or herbicides to keep your garden weed-free.

Skipping Mulching
Mulching offers numerous benefits like moisture retention and temperature regulation. Skipping mulch can leave soil exposed to extreme weather, damaging roots. Apply a layer of organic mulch around plants, ensuring they are protected and can grow optimally.
Fertilizer Misuse
Applying too much fertilizer can burn plants, while too little may not provide needed nutrients. Follow package instructions carefully and use a balanced fertilizer suited for your plants’ specific needs. This approach ensures healthy growth without causing harm.
